Dual wielding Assassin is a heavy glass cannon build yep. I tend to go dual wielding for Warfare builds lol. Rogue or Hunting can go Spear pretty easily so I can see spear Assassin being pretty good through some other combos like Warden, Haruspex, Pilgrim would likely be higher tier for spear.
If played correctly, it will very rare that a monster get the chance to touch you. The posibility to apply rogue's poisons at range is incredible OP. Maxing attack speed and movement speed you are untouchable, extremely safe build. It became my favorite and strongest build I ever tried. This one for sure deserves a try.
A resume would be: High physical/poison damage with tremendously increased damage in piercing/bleeding (boosted by both masteries), Best single target DPS, really GOOD AOE damage (shreding through enemies).

I noticed that you mentioned a lot of great builds, but I dont see my 2 main builds that I think that are really good. So I mention this to maybe help new players or veterans that didnt try all the posible existant builds.
My first build is the Assassin (Rogue/Warfare) melee build with OK aoe and really good single target DPS. If played dual wielding, you will have low defense/resistances. I prefer spear/shield.
It deserves a try, really fun to play.
